> According to a discussion we had it seems like we need to support both private and public IP addresses for load balancing. The reason being that if the load balancer is placed outside a network of an IaaS the load balancer might need to use the private IP addresses of the members to delegate the requests. 
> At the moment cloud controller is only sending the private IP address of the members. We might need to extend this to send both private and public IP addresses.
> The idea is to have a configuration in the load balancer to specify whether to use private or public IP addresses for load balancing. Appreciate your thoughts on this.
